Output faefa35d3fb3dc5dc4d83c70081324cfd050240bc9fca5ca495aa4b394d2efd5:0

value
28383488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c62e0b4e9164f0c85331c81bd67b186400d20cb5 OP_EQUAL
address
3KktsjMRw4c1ZnpmTJzwVBy2e2S3T2qZHs
transaction
faefa35d3fb3dc5dc4d83c70081324cfd050240bc9fca5ca495aa4b394d2efd5
confirmations
290785
spent
true